Sports Group rises for Goodluck

A one-day sports campaign was held in honour of President Goodluck Jonathan at the National Stadium, Lagos at the weekend.

The event, which was held by a group, Sports People for Jonathan,  in partnership with Neighbour to Neighbour group had sportsmen holding demonstrations in basketball, boxing, kung fu, tug-of-war while participants also took part in the keep-fit exercises.

President of the Nigeria Olympian Association (NOA), Henry Amike, who is also the head of mobilization for the group, noted that it was unique for athletes to support a Presidential candidate.

Amike, a former 400 metres hurdles champion also said that the prompt payment of athletes’ allowances and winning bonus at the last Commonwealth Games in India showed that Jonathan was committed to the welfare of athletes.
